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,069 per month in Port Louis vs $936 in Riviere Du Rempart,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,712 per month in Port Louis vs $1,516 in Riviere Du Rempart,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,356 per month in Port Louis vs $2,096 in Riviere Du Rempart, rent included.

Port Louis costs about 14% more than Riviere Du Rempart,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.

Both Port Louis and Riviere Du Rempart are more affordable than the global median – Port Louis 20% lower, Riviere Du Rempart 30%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$463 in Port Louis versus $507 in Riviere Du Rempart.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 58% higher in Port Louis,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$45.00 in Port Louis versus $25.00 in Riviere Du Rempart.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$232 vs $203 – making Riviere Du Rempart the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
